Content strategists shape brand narratives, ensuring alignment with audience needs and market trends. High demand in the UK reflects the growing importance of digital storytelling.
Editorial managers oversee content production, ensuring quality and consistency. Their role is critical in publishing and media industries, with competitive salary ranges.
Copywriters craft compelling messages for marketing and advertising. Their skills are in high demand across industries, reflecting the need for persuasive communication.
